FTP客户端上传文件到服务器:本地Linux主机使用FTP上传文件到Linux云服务器
(图片来源网络,侵删)在现代的互联网环境中,文件传输协议(FTP)仍然是一种广泛使用的数据传输方式,它允许用户在不同的系统之间传输文件,特别是在本地Linux主机与Linux云服务器之间,本文将详细介绍如何使用FTP客户端从本地Linux主机上传文件至Linux云服务器的过程。
准备工作
1. 选择合适的FTP客户端
对于Linux环境,有多种FTP客户端可供选择,如FileZilla、vsftpd、proftpd等,根据个人喜好和具体需求选择适合的FTP客户端。
2. 安装FTP客户端
以FileZilla为例,可以通过以下命令进行安装:
sudo aptget update sudo aptget install filezilla
3. 配置云服务器FTP服务
(图片来源网络,侵删)确保你的云服务器上已经安装并配置好FTP服务,大多数云服务商提供相应的文档来指导这一过程。
连接至云服务器
1. 获取必要的连接信息
需要以下信息来连接到FTP服务器:
服务器地址:通常是IP地址或域名。
端口号:FTP默认端口是21,但有时可能会使用其他端口。
用户名和密码:用于验证连接到服务器的凭证。
(图片来源网络,侵删)2. 使用FTP客户端连接
启动FileZilla客户端,输入上述信息进行连接。
上传文件
1. 定位本地文件
在FileZilla的界面中,找到左侧的本地站点窗口,浏览你的文件系统,定位到你想要上传的文件或文件夹。
2. 选择目标目录
在右侧的远程站点窗口,导航到云服务器上的目标目录,这是你希望上传文件的位置。
3. 开始上传
将左侧窗口中的文件或文件夹拖拽到右侧窗口的目标目录,或者右键点击文件选择上传。
安全性考虑
1. 使用加密连接
尽可能使用FTP over TLS/SSL (FTPS)或SFTP来保护你的数据在传输过程中不被截取。
2. 强密码策略
使用复杂且不易猜测的密码,定期更换密码以维护账户安全。
故障排除
1. 连接问题
检查网络连接:确保你的设备可以访问互联网。
确认服务器地址和端口:再次检查是否有误。
防火墙设置:确认没有阻止FTP客户端的网络连接。
2. 权限问题
文件权限:确保你对要上传的文件有足够的权限。
服务器权限:确认你的FTP账户有权限写入目标目录。
性能优化
1. 使用并行传输
大多数FTP客户端支持多线程下载/上传,这可以提高传输速率。
2. 压缩文件
在上传前对文件进行压缩,可以减少传输时间和带宽消耗。
FAQs
Q1: 如何确定我是否成功连接到FTP服务器?
A1: 成功连接后,FileZilla通常会在状态栏显示“连接建立”以及一些服务器响应信息,你可以在远程站点窗口看到云服务器上的目录结构。
Q2: 如果上传失败,我应该怎么做?
A2: 首先检查网络连接是否正常,确认你有正确的登录凭据和足够的权限,查看FTP客户端的错误日志,可能会有详细的失败原因,如果问题依旧无法解决,可能需要联系云服务商的技术支持寻求帮助。
通过遵循以上步骤,你可以有效地从本地Linux主机使用FTP客户端上传文件到Linux云服务器,记得总是关注安全性和性能优化的最佳实践,以确保数据传输既快速又安全。
上一篇:a10与9700配什么主板
下一篇:操作系统存储物理结构_物理参数